Output d51c902277b80c734ce3060322034f6c914efa4f472a1f581e75e1ea9f8e7ff1:1

value
6979632942203
script pubkey
OP_0 OP_PUSHBYTES_20 859a40a71a51f8f88fc4aa6e87657e80e7c4d385
address
tb1qskdypfc628u03r7y4fhgwet7srnuf5u975nk4j
transaction
d51c902277b80c734ce3060322034f6c914efa4f472a1f581e75e1ea9f8e7ff1
confirmations
191798
spent
true